Output 5b86ff94bd1605aa54c1c18488d1529306983e4939855f9a8d8ed0c6912eb526:2

value
1106800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b263c39eaee763fac0ecbf49870be9649708814 OP_EQUAL
address
3BTa2hfee2fNLZNQwitKwxoDEU6t2PEmcz
transaction
5b86ff94bd1605aa54c1c18488d1529306983e4939855f9a8d8ed0c6912eb526
spent
true